First ever Tamil street festival in Toronto this weekend

Toronto's first ever Tamil Festival is happening this weekend in Morningside Heights. Organized by the Canadian Tamil Congress, the event will showcase live music and dance performances, a mobile museum detailing Tamil Canadian history and of course, plenty of food.

Some of the food vendors expected to attend include Hopper Hut, Lingan Cream House and Yarl Dosa Corner.

More than 300,000 Tamil Canadians reside in the GTA and this inaugural street fest will unfold over August 29 and 30. It's all happening on Morningside between Finch and Nielson Road and more than 20 food vendors are lined up to serve crowds over the two days celebration.
